Ali McCann

From Wikipedia, the free encyclopedia
Jump to navigation Jump to search

Alistair McCann
Personal information
Full name Alistair Edward McCann[1]
Date of birth (1999-12-04) 4 December 1999 (age 26)
Place of birth Edinburgh, Scotland
Height 1.76 m (5 ft 9 in)[2]
Position Midfielder
Team information
Current team
Preston North End
Number 8
Youth career
Hutchison Vale Boys Club
2012–2017 St Johnstone
Senior career*
Years Team Apps (Gls)
2017–2021 St Johnstone 71 (6)
2019Stranraer (loan) 13 (1)
2021– Preston North End 130 (2)
International career
Northern Ireland youth
2019–2020 Northern Ireland U21 6 (0)
2020– Northern Ireland[3] 33 (1)
* Club domestic league appearances and goals as of 20:29, 21 October 2025 (UTC)
‡ National team caps and goals as of 13 October 2025

Alistair Edward McCann (born 4 December 1999) is a professional footballer who plays as a midfielder for EFL Championship club Preston North End. Born in Scotland, he represents Northern Ireland at international level.

Early and personal life

[edit | edit source]

Born in Edinburgh,[4] McCann and his brothers Lewis (who is also a footballer) and Ross (who is Scotland and GB 7s rugby player) were born and raised in Scotland to a Northern Irish father and an English mother.[5]

Club career

[edit | edit source]

McCann moved from Hutchison Vale Boys Club to St Johnstone in 2012.[4] He made his senior debut on 29 January 2018.[6]

McCann joined Stranraer on loan in February 2019.[7][8]

In May 2021 he was monitored by Celtic.[9] He moved to Preston North End on 31 August 2021.[10]

International career

[edit | edit source]

McCann has played youth football for Northern Ireland, including at under-21 level.[2][11]

On 15 November 2020, McCann made his senior international debut, against Austria.[2][12]

In October 2023 he pulled out of the Northern Ireland squad due to injury.[13]

Career statistics

[edit | edit source]
As of match played 21 October 2025
Appearances and goals by club, season and competition
Club Season League National cup[a] League cup[b] Other Total
Division Apps Goals Apps Goals Apps Goals Apps Goals Apps Goals
St Johnstone 2016–17[14] Scottish Premiership 0 0 0 0 0 0 1[c] 0 1 0
2017–18[6] Scottish Premiership 3 0 1 0 0 0 1[c] 0 5 0
2018–19[15] Scottish Premiership 1 0 0 0 1 0 1[c] 0 3 0
2019–20[16] Scottish Premiership 29 4 3 0 3 0 0 0 35 4
2020–21[17] Scottish Premiership 34 2 5 0 4 0 0 0 43 2
2021–22[18] Scottish Premiership 4 0 0 0 1 0 4[d] 0 9 0
Total 71 6 9 0 9 0 7 0 96 6
Stranraer (loan) 2018–19[15] Scottish League One 13 1 0 0 0 0 0 0 13 1
Preston North End 2021–22[18] EFL Championship 28 1 1 0 2 0 0 0 31 1
2022–23[19] EFL Championship 31 0 2 0 2 2 0 0 35 2
2023–24[20] EFL Championship 31 0 1 0 1 0 0 0 33 0
2024–25[21] EFL Championship 29 1 3 0 2 0 0 0 34 1
2025–26[22] Championship 11 0 0 0 1 0 12 0
Total 130 2 7 0 8 2 0 0 145 4
Career total 214 9 16 0 17 2 7 0 254 11
  1. ^ Includes Scottish Cup, FA Cup
  2. ^ Includes Scottish League Cup, EFL Cup
  3. ^ a b c Appearances for the U20 team in Scottish League Challenge Cup.
  4. ^ Appearances in UEFA Europa League

Honours

[edit | edit source]

St Johnstone

References

[edit | edit source]
  1. ^ Ali McCann at WorldFootball.netLua error in Module:EditAtWikidata at line 29: attempt to index field 'wikibase' (a nil value).
  2. ^ a b c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  3.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).Lua error in Module:WikidataCheck at line 29: attempt to index field 'wikibase' (a nil value).
  4. ^ a b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  5.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  6. ^ a b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  7.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  8.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  9.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  10.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  11.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  12.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  13.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  14.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  15. ^ a b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  16.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  17.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  18. ^ a b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  19.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  20.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  21.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  22.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  23.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).
  24. ^ Lua error in Module:Citation/CS1/Configuration at line 2172: attempt to index field '?' (a nil value).